Music on iPhone/iPad grouped bizarrely despite being fine on iTunes
Question
I have some 'albums' in my iTunes library that look fine to me:
However, when I sync them to my phone and iPad, they become grouped in really weird ways:
If I play the album, all the songs are actually on the device:
I just can't see them in the actual listing.
I thought it might be the "Grouping" field in iTunes, but it's empty for all the songs, and the behaviour persists (even after several of the files have been replaced).
How do I get my devices to show me all my songs, not these weirdly grouped swap ins? I'm on Windows, if it makes a difference.
Solution
Found it!
There is an additional field in the data: “Work”. It doesn’t appear in the “Edit info” box, but you can make it appear as a column in playlists and the like.
The misbehaving tracks had had “Work” values set; I deleted them, synced it across, and then they were showing up as expected.
Note that editing this field doesn’t seem to qualify as an “edit” for the sync to pick up automatically, so I had to modify something else to make it re-copy those files. (I added a space to the end of the song name, synced, then removed the space and synced again.
